Transaction 93317331291cee157aafb74056c9f95453ff98140744fb2715086b6ccaf5139f

1 Input
2 Outputs
  • 93317331291cee157aafb74056c9f95453ff98140744fb2715086b6ccaf5139f:0
  • value  5099502
    address  2MxMSiaqxZJEFXfQ2uAXAr6MvdaSDvLtQjF
  • 93317331291cee157aafb74056c9f95453ff98140744fb2715086b6ccaf5139f:1
  • value  1000000
    address  2N8mho2S4BBJU78vw2U5a91mWSEZA61fwHd